The ‘Why Learn Chinese?’ PDF (29 pages) will introduce students to the reasons people find learning Chinese, meaningful in their lives.
They will explore business reasons, cultural reasons, cognitive reasons, travel reasons, and job opportunities. So whether or not their future career includes speaking Chinese, the cognitive benefits are real.
Teachers of Chinese can present this slideshow to the students demonstrating why Chinese is an important language. After viewing, students can discuss what they learned in small groups.
At the end of the slideshow, students will complete a 15-minute individual task based on answering the following questions:
Write your thoughts about learning Chinese.
What questions do you have about China and Chinese?
Tell me something about yourself, so I can get to know you better.
This student feedback instantly ‘takes the temperature’ of your class. It tells you how students feel about learning Chinese, gives you areas of misunderstanding you can correct, and you will learn a little about the students themselves.
